Face Validity
The extent to which a test appears to measure what it is supposed to measure at face value.
Naturalist Intelligence
A type of intelligence described by Howard Gardner, involving sensitivity to and understanding of the natural world and living things.
Intrapersonal Intelligence
A type of intelligence that involves the capacity to understand oneself, including one's emotions, motivations, and thoughts.
Bodily-Kinesthetic Intelligence
A type of intelligence characterized by the ability to control bodily motions and handle objects skillfully.
